I've been tasked with installing either freebsd or netbsd on a compaq
proliant 1850R (two really).  I'd prefer FreeBSD as I have a little more
experience with it.  The problem I have is this. 
They have somewhat of an odd configuration.

In their current setup (with unixware 7.1), these two machines "share" a
raid unit.  The raid controller is a smart card, which I see from the
hcl is supported.  My question is, is it possible to set two installs of
freebsd up so that they can share the same raid disk?  They are to be
part of a crazy database cluster.  If so, is there documentation on
this?
